HBO Announces Premiere Date/Time for “Animals” Season Two
Plus preview stills!
In a new press release issued by HBO, the second season of Animals has officially been announced with a premiere date/time. Here’s an excerpt from the announcement:
ANIMALS. kicks off its ten-episode second season FRIDAY, MARCH 17 (11:30 p.m.-midnight ET/PT). Created by Phil Matarese & Mike Luciano and produced by Duplass Brothers Television, this animated adult comedy series focuses on the downtrodden creatures native to Earth’s least-habitable environment: New York City. Whether it’s lovelorn rats, gender-questioning pigeons or aging bedbugs in the midst of a midlife crisis, the awkward small talk, moral ambiguity and existential woes of non-human urbanites prove startlingly similar to our own.
